On Fri, 2004-05-21 at 18:23, Andy Currid wrote:
> This patch fixes a PCI interrupt routing bug that shows up when
> running
> on x86_64 with ACPI and IOAPIC functionality enabled. Without this
> patch
> in place, the code attempts to route all configurable PCI interrupts
> to
> IRQ 0.
